Forward Like-Kind Exchange
The first thing we need to cover is what exactly a forward 1031 exchange is. Section 1031 of the Internal Revenue Code exists to incentivize investment in real property. A 1031 exchange allows you to defer the gains accumulated during the sale of property and re-invest those proceeds into newer property, thus avoiding a big tax hit. A forward 1031 exchange is the most common type of exchange and refers to the order in which you relinquish and receive property. In a forward exchange you sell your old property first, and then identify and close on your new replacement property (the process is reversed with a reverse 1031 exchange).

In order to complete a successful forward 1031 exchange, you first need to satisfy the 1031 holding requirement. That means that your old relinquished property and your new replacement property both need to be held for investment or business purposes. Property held for personal use does not qualify for 1031 treatment. Furthermore, your property needs to be like-kind as defined by the IRS. If you’re exchanging real estate for real estate, most property is considered like-kind. For example, a Bemidji hotel can be exchanged for a piece of farmland outside of town. Finally, it’s essential to go up in your value, equity, and debt when you exchange into your new property.
